abstract

In this paper, we extend the structure theorem for smooth projective varieties with nef tangent bundle to projective klt varieties whose tangent sheaf is either positively curved or almost nef. Specifically, we show that such a variety $X$, up to a finite quasi-\'etale cover, admits a rationally connected fibration $X \to A$ onto an abelian variety $A$. For the proof, we develop the theory of positivity of coherent sheaves on projective varieties. As applications, we establish some relations between the geometric properties and positivity of tangent sheaves.
